YOUTHMED Launches Call in Spain to select 3 Youth Organizations to Support Local Implementation and Inclusion

Three youth organizations in Seville-Spain will be selected through a new FCCSEV call to advance YOUTHMED’s mission of inclusive youth participation and cross-border cooperation.

The Foundation of the Chamber of Commerce of Seville (FCCSEV) has launched a call for tenders to select three youth organizations in Spain to support the implementation of YOUTHMED activities at the local level.

Selected organizations will contribute to strengthening youth participation and inclusion by:

• Delivering training on civic engagement and digital tools
• Organizing awareness events on gender equality and social inclusion
• Supporting vulnerable youth through mentoring and co-designed initiatives
• Mobilizing participants for cross-border exchanges
• Engaging community stakeholders in public events
